Understanding Breach of Fiduciary Duty

A fiduciary duty requires trust and loyalty. When a person in a position of trust acts against the interests of another party this can be a breach that gives rise to legal remedies.

Common examples include self dealing conflicts of interest failure to disclose material information or misappropriation of assets.

Definition and Explanation

A fiduciary duty is a legal obligation to act in the best interests of another person or entity. It requires candor loyalty and care in decision making.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include duty breach causation damages and remedy. The process often starts with gathering documents interviewing witnesses and preserving evidence before pursuing claim or defense.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ary of terms used in fiduciary duty cases includes fiduciary duty breach conflict of interest and damages.

Fiduciary Duty

A legal obligation to act in the best interests of another party.

Breach

Failure to meet a fiduciary duty that harms the other party.

Conflict of Interest

A situation where personal interests could influence decisions.

Damages and Remedies

Monetary compensation restitution or court orders to stop harm and make the harmed party whole.
